On 25-Oct-2004, "Walter Cohen" wrote:

Part of the reason I leave the window open constantly is to help prevent ice
dams in the winter.


In the long run, it will probably be cheaper to insulate more and prevent
ice dams that way. Ice dams are a sign of insufficient insulation.

Would it be better to insulate the walls between the heated rooms and the
attic space and continue to leave the window open?


One way or the other you should look at fixing the insulation. Either
enclosing and insulating the empty space or insulating the empty space
to separate it from the heated space. Decide which is cheaper/easier.
Take care of the venting while you're at it.
